1942 Simca 5 vs. 2010 Daewoo Lacetti
To start off, 2010 Daewoo Lacetti is newer by 68 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1942 Simca 5.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1942 Simca 5 would be higher. At 1,597 cc (4 cylinders), 2010 Daewoo Lacetti is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2010 Daewoo Lacetti (108 HP) has 94 more horse power than 1942 Simca 5. (14 HP) In normal driving conditions, 2010 Daewoo Lacetti should accelerate faster than 1942 Simca 5.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2010 Daewoo Lacetti weights approximately 695 kg more than 1942 Simca 5.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Because 1942 Simca 5 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1942 Simca 5.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2010 Daewoo Lacetti,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
